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 4 people
Calories 247 kcal

Equipment

  • 1 bowl
  • 1 baking dish
  • 1 grill or grill pan
  • 1 platter
  • 1 small bowl

Ingredients
  

  • 4 tuna steaks (8 ounces each) 
  • 1 cup arugula, torn or chopped into large pieces
  • 2 large tomatoes, diced (I like to use a combination of red, yellow and green tomatoes - but that is just for appearance!)
  • 2 tablespoons capers, chopped (optional)
  • ½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 garlic clove, minced or pressed
  • 1 shallot (or small red onion), finely chopped
  • 1 teaspoon honey
  • 1 tablespoon fresh chopped oregano (or 2 teaspoons dried oregano)
  • zest of 1 whole lemon
  • 3 tablespoons  lemon juice

Instructions
 

  • Combine the shallot, garlic, oregano, lemon juice, lemon zest, salt, black pepper and honey in a bowl; slowly add the oil while whisking constantly.
  • Place the tuna steaks in a baking dish and drizzle 1/2 cup of the vinaigrette over the steaks; turn them around to coat both sides. Heat a grill or grill pan over high heat, and place the tuna steaks (in a single layer) on the grill.
  • Cook about 4 minutes per side for medium rare, longer if you like your steaks more well done. Remove from grill and transfer to a platter to keep warm.
  • Mix the tomatoes, arugula, capers and remaining vinaigrette together in a small bowl and mix well to combine. Serve alongside the tuna steaks.

Notes

Freshness is Key: When it comes to tuna, freshness is crucial. Opt for high-quality tuna steaks from a trusted fishmonger. Look for vibrant color, firm texture, and a fresh oceanic aroma.
